Twisted Sides Bun Tutorial

Image
   Hello and happy weekend to you all! I hope that you have had a splendid first few days of 2014. My week has been spent in drawing, volunteering, studying God's word, watching movies and visiting with friends. :)    This evening, I am pleased to present my second hair tutorial! Tonight's updo is a simple bun with two twists of hair on each side of the head. Twisted hair is one of my favorite ways to add uncomplicated elegance to my hair. This style is tailor-made to my lengthy tresses, but there is no reason it shouldn't work with a shoulder-length cut. If your hair is any shorter, you may need to experiment with your own lovely variation. :)   1. I begin by twisting a section of hair from the top of my head on one side of my part. 2. Costumes

Image
  Where I come from, costumes are a big deal. Since being in my teens, I've gone to way more events in costume than I ever did when I was little! My repertoire includes costume birthday parties, a ball, and a few medieval festivals. It's a good thing that I like fashion so much. ;)   In my area, we are blessed to have several consignment stores that have vintage clothing and costumes. I have never had to order a costume off of the internet. Not everyone has the advantage of great local stores, but with a little ingenuity, you can pull together a marvelous outfit for your next dress up event!           This was my costume for a nineteen twenties party. I searched high and low for a drop-waist dress (that wasn't an eighties prom dress), but couldn't find what I was looking for. Enter this lacy black frock.
